Viveta is a topical anesthetic cream containing a combination of lidocaine (7% w/w) and tetracaine (7% w/w). Manufactured by Ajanta Pharma, it is used to provide local anesthesia for minor dermatological and surgical procedures, including laser treatments, tattoo removal, dermal filler injections, and skin biopsies. The mechanism of action involves the reversible blockade of voltage-gated sodium channels in nerve fibers, which inhibits the ionic fluxes required for the initiation and conduction of pain impulses. Following topical application, the cream typically induces numbness within the treated area that lasts for approximately one to two hours.
